One of the key kinds of these additives is plastic pigment, which is available in numerous shades and types depending upon the wanted outcome for the plastic product. When going over pigments in this domain name, we frequently refer to compounds that pass on color by altering the way light interacts with a things's surface area. Unlike dyes, pigments are insoluble in plastic and needs to be carefully ground to disperse within the plastic matrix, offering regular pigmentation. This difference not only highlights the chemical composition yet additionally influences the application method and end-use performance of tinted plastics.

Of the several pigments available, certain ones like Pigment Yellow 180 and Pigment Yellow 14, additionally known as PY14, have actually gotten importance due to their preferable properties. Pigment Yellow 180 is particularly notable for its superior warmth security, exceptional lightfastness, and resistance to migration, making it a favored selection for coloring plastics used in other and automotive outdoor applications.

Similarly, Pigment Blue 60 complements the range by supplying one more important color choice used throughout sectors. Its brilliant hue is not simply limited to boosting visual appeal-- this pigment is likewise valued for its particle dimension distribution, which makes certain smooth dispersion in plastic products.
